Alternate Name: Achiote Molido
From Mexico. Considered “Cuban turmeric,” achiote lends its mild sweet and earthy aroma and subtle flavor to a variety to Latin American, Caribbean and Southeast Asian recipes. You can skip the seed grinding part and make your own achiote paste for cochinita pibil, a popular Mexican spicy pork dish or Pescado en Achiote (Mexican Fish in Annatto Sauce).
